The original Terminator film was a masterpiece of relatively low-budget filmmaking. As much as I enjoyed Terminator:Salvation, it was a case of "Here is a shiitload of money, go and splurge it filmmaking". For some reason, the higher the actual budget of a film, the less work and money goes into things like scripting, etc. And usually the movies suffer for it. Another good example. The original Matrix film was made for less than half the budget of the sequels. Which one would you rather watch? Another good example. Monty Python and the Holy Grail. Budget 220,000 pounds. Monty Python's Meaning of Life - $9 million budget. Once again, I know which one I would rather watch. Taksraven -
